The Bible offers profound wisdom and encouragement for those facing challenges in life. It provides insights into how challenges are an integral part of the human experience. The scriptures often encourage believers to view obstacles not as insurmountable barriers but as opportunities for growth and deepening faith. Through stories and teachings, the Bible reassures us that God is present during our trials and offers guidance and strength. By turning to these teachings, we can find solace in knowing that our struggles have purpose and that perseverance is key. As we face difficulties, the Bible reminds us to trust in God’s plan and to remain steadfast in our faith.
“I can do all things through Christ which strengtheneth me”
— Philippians 4:13
“My brethren, count it all joy when ye fall into divers temptationsKnowing this, that the trying of your faith worketh patienceBut let patience have her perfect work, that ye may be perfect entire, wanting nothing”
— James 1:2-4
“Casting all your care upon him; for he careth for you”
— 1 Peter 5:7
“Trust in the Lord with all thine heart; lean not unto thine own understandingIn all thy ways acknowledge him, he shall direct thy paths”
— Proverbs 3:5-6
During difficult times, finding strength can be a challenge, but the Bible provides numerous verses that inspire and uplift. These scriptures serve as reminders of God’s unwavering presence and the strength He offers to His followers. The teachings encourage believers to rely on God’s power rather than their own, emphasizing that true strength comes from faith. By focusing on these verses, individuals can find the courage to endure tough situations and emerge stronger. They remind us that trials are temporary, but God’s love and support are eternal, providing a source of comfort and resilience.
“Fear thou not; for I am with thee: be not dismayed; for I am thy God: I will strengthen thee; yea, I will help thee; yea, I will uphold thee with the right hand of my righteousness”
— Isaiah 41:10
“God is our refuge strength, a very present help in trouble”
— Psalm 46:1
“Then he said unto them, Go your way, eat the fat, drink the sweet, send portions unto them for whom nothing is prepared: for this day is holy unto our Lord : neither be ye sorry; for the joy of the Lord is your strength”
— Nehemiah 8:10
“For God hath not given us the spirit of fear; but of power, of love, of a sound mind”
— 2 Timothy 1:7

Perseverance and faith are central themes in the Bible, especially in the context of adversity. The scriptures highlight the significance of enduring hardships with a steadfast spirit and unwavering belief in God’s promises. These verses encourage believers to remain faithful even when circumstances are challenging, assuring them that perseverance is rewarded. The Bible provides numerous examples of individuals who demonstrated remarkable perseverance, serving as role models for today’s believers. By meditating on these verses, individuals can find the motivation to continue their journey with hope and resilience, knowing that God is with them every step of the way.
“Not only so, but we glory in tribulations also: knowing that tribulation worketh patienceAnd patience, experience; experience, hope”
— Romans 5:3-4
“For ye have need of patience, that, after ye have done the will of God, ye might receive the promise”
— Hebrews 10:36
“Let us not be weary in well doing: for in due season we shall reap, if we faint not”
— Galatians 6:9
“But ye, brethren, be not weary in well doing”
— 2 Thessalonians 3:13

Prayer is a powerful tool for overcoming obstacles, and the Bible offers numerous verses to guide individuals in their prayers during challenging times. These scriptures emphasize the importance of turning to God in prayer, seeking His wisdom and strength to navigate difficulties. Prayer is portrayed as a means of communicating with God, expressing burdens, and receiving comfort and guidance. By focusing on these verses, believers can deepen their prayer life, finding peace and clarity amidst life’s challenges. The Bible encourages persistent prayer, trusting that God hears and responds to the cries of His people.
“Be careful for nothing; but in every thing by prayer supplication with thanksgiving let your requests be made known unto GodAnd the peace of God, which passeth all understanding, shall keep your hearts minds through Christ Jesus”
— Philippians 4:6-7
“All things, whatsoever ye shall ask in prayer, believing, ye shall receive”
— Matthew 21:22
“Pray without ceasing”
— 1 Thessalonians 5:17
“The righteous cry, the Lord heareth, delivereth them out of all their troubles”
— Psalm 34:17
